Which of the following best describes one of the roles of RNA?

  • A. Manufacturing the proteins needed from DNA
  • B. Creating the bonds between the elements that make up DNA
  • C. Sending messages about the correct sequence of proteins in DNA
  • D. Forming the identifiable double helix shape of DNA
Correct Answer: C

Rationale: The correct answer is C. RNA serves as a messenger that carries instructions from DNA for protein synthesis. It does not manufacture proteins directly from DNA (choice A), create bonds within DNA (choice B), or form the double helix structure of DNA (choice D). Therefore, the primary role of RNA is to convey information about the correct sequence of proteins to be synthesized based on the DNA sequences it receives.
